Hi All....

When clicking on applications in the HD toolbar, the page is blank that used to display my apps. They have somehow been moved down past the jump. When I scroll down to try to access them, I get the spinning beachball and after a minute or two the page quits. I can't get to my app icons to use them. Any ideas? I'm spending a lot of time with spinning beachballs and no results. G4 iMac 512ram 80gig Newbie here. Thank you for your help.

open the HD icon on your desktop. On the left are the list of common locations,
eg Desktop, userloginid, Applications, Documents, Movies, Music, Pictures

On the right (using a list view, not the icon view) is a tree view of all the folders.

Next to Applications, on its immediate left, is a small arrow pointing right.
Click on it once; it will rotate to point down. You should see all kinds of
programs there. IF SO, you need to fix your ICON view;

First change the view to ICONs,
then use view menu again to ARRANGE (by name, date, whatever you please)
